How to Build the Perfect RPA Developer Resume: With Templates and Tips
Updated on Feb 12, 2025 | 20 min read | 10.3k views
Share:
For working professionals
For fresh graduates
More
Updated on Feb 12, 2025 | 20 min read | 10.3k views
Share:
Table of Contents
A strong RPA developer resume is essential in today’s competitive job market, as it highlights your technical skills and ability to address the growing demand for automation across industries. With Robotic Process Automation (RPA) increasingly adopted by businesses worldwide, a well-crafted resume can greatly improve your chances of landing interviews and advancing your career.
This blog provides practical guidance on building an impactful resume by emphasizing key skills, experience, and certifications, helping you stand out to potential employers.
Creating an effective RPA developer resume requires proper planning with attention to detail. It should effectively highlight both technical skills and relevant experience. By understanding the job requirements, choosing the right format, and highlighting your achievements and qualifications, you can create a standout resume.
This guide will ensure your resume aligns with industry standards and showcases your potential as an RPA developer.
1. Analyze the Job Description and Company Requirements
The first step in crafting a targeted RPA developer resume is to thoroughly analyze the job description. This allows you to tailor your resume to meet the employer’s specific needs and expectations. Key elements to focus on include:
Example: If the job posting mentions a requirement for knowledge of UiPath and robotic process automation, ensure you emphasize your proficiency with these tools in your resume.
2. Choose a Suitable Resume Format (Chronological, Functional, or Combination)
Choosing the right format for your RPA developer resume is essential for presenting your experience in the best light. Here’s a breakdown of the most common formats:
This format lists your work experience in reverse chronological order, emphasizing career progression. Use this format if you have steady, relevant experience in RPA development, as it highlights your professional growth and accomplishments in the field.
A functional resume focuses on skills and achievements, rather than a detailed work history. Opt for this format if you have gaps in your employment or are transitioning from a different field, such as IT, to RPA development. It allows you to focus on your capabilities without emphasizing the timeline of your career.
The combination format integrates both skills and work experience, making it ideal for showcasing your technical expertise while also demonstrating your career progression. This format is best for experienced RPA developers, as it allows you to highlight your accomplishments while also detailing your work history and key projects.
Example: If you’ve worked in IT and now have experience in RPA, a combination format can showcase both your previous IT background and your new skills in automation development.
3. Write a Professional Summary Tailored to the Role
A well-written professional summary highlights your RPA expertise and key achievements in just a few lines. This section should be concise and tailored to the specific RPA developer resume role you’re applying for.
Example: "Experienced RPA Developer with 4 years of expertise in designing, developing, and deploying automation solutions using UiPath and Automation Anywhere. Skilled in process optimization and smart contract automation, seeking to use my experience to drive operational efficiencies for Gajalakshmi Enterprises."
Also Read: Automation vs AI in 2025: Key Differences and How They're Shaping the Future
The summary should provide a snapshot of your skills, experience, and how you can add value to the role.
4. Emphasize Work Experience with Specific Achievements
Focus on your RPA contributions with quantifiable results. Be sure to include:
When describing your experience, focus on quantifiable results to showcase your impact:
Example: "Developed and deployed 20+ automation bots using UiPath, improving process efficiency by 40% and saving the company INR 10,000,00 annually in operational costs."
This section should focus on results rather than just listing tasks. Employers want to see how your work benefits the organization.
5. Highlight Technical and Soft Skills
Showcase both technical skills and soft skills to demonstrate your ability to collaborate and problem-solve. Key technical skills include. Equally important are your soft skills, which demonstrate your ability to work collaboratively and solve problems.
Example: "Proficient in UiPath, Automation Anywhere, and Python. Strong problem-solving abilities with a track record of improving process efficiency through automation. Excellent communication and collaboration skills, having worked closely with cross-functional teams."
Also Read: Hard Skills vs Soft Skills: Key Differences Explained
6. Include Educational Qualifications and Certifications
While a degree in Computer Science or a related field is often preferred, certifications in RPA tools can be a significant advantage to your resume.
Certifications such as UiPath, Blue Prism, or Automation Anywhere validate your skills and show your commitment to professional development.
7. Proofread and Optimize for ATS Compatibility
Optimize your resume for Applicant Tracking Systems (ATS) by using job-specific keywords. ATS scans resumes for keywords that match the job description, so:
Example: If the job description mentions process automation, ensure this phrase appears on your resume.
By following these steps, you will create a well-rounded RPA developer resume that not only highlights your skills and achievements but also aligns with industry expectations.
With these steps covered, let’s focus on the sections that every RPA resume should have.
Creating a well-organized RPA developer resume is essential for making a strong impression. A structured resume helps recruiters quickly identify key information and assess your qualifications.
This section will break down the essential components of an RPA developer resume, ensuring all critical aspects are covered to make your application stand out in the competitive job market. Let’s have a look at these one by one:
1. Professional Summary: Concise and Impactful Overview
Your professional summary should provide a quick snapshot of who you are, highlighting your experience, skills, and career aspirations. Tailor it to the specific RPA developer role you are applying for, emphasizing the key qualifications employers are looking for. This section should grab the recruiter’s attention and encourage them to continue reading.
Example: "Experienced RPA Developer with 5+ years of expertise in developing automation solutions using UiPath and Automation Anywhere. Skilled in process optimization, robotic process automation, and cross-functional team collaboration. Seeking to use my automation skills to improve operational efficiencies and drive business growth."
Also Read: The Ultimate Guide To Top 20 RPA Tools And Which One To Choose in 2025
The summary should be brief but impactful, offering a concise introduction to your skills and experience.
2. Work Experience: Detailed Roles and Achievements
Work experience is the most important section of your RPA developer resume. This section should focus on the specific roles you’ve held, your responsibilities, and the achievements you’ve made. It’s essential to highlight how your contributions have improved processes, saved costs, or enhanced productivity, with measurable outcomes wherever possible.
Example: "Developed and deployed 25+ RPA bots using UiPath for automating business processes across finance, HR, and customer service. Led the automation of a manual invoicing system, reducing processing time by 40%, saving INR 150,000 annually."
This section should demonstrate your ability to solve real-world problems and show how your RPA solutions have made a significant impact on business outcomes.
3. Education: Relevant Degrees and Institutions
While work experience is essential, educational qualifications provide context for your technical skills. Mention your highest degree and relevant coursework that has prepared you for an RPA development role. Also, if you’ve completed any specialized training in RPA or related fields, include that as well.
Example: "Bachelor's in Computer Science, Gajalakshmi University
Relevant Coursework: Data Structures, Algorithms, Robotics, Automation Systems"
If you have certifications (e.g., UiPath Certified RPA Developer or Automation Anywhere Certified Professional), list those here as well to add weight to your technical qualifications.
4. Skills: Both Technical (e.g., UiPath, Python) and Soft Skills (e.g., Teamwork, Problem-Solving)
In this section, focus on the skills that are directly relevant to an RPA developer role. These can be broken down into two categories: technical skills and soft skills. Technical skills showcase your ability to work with RPA tools and programming languages, while soft skills demonstrate your ability to collaborate and problem-solve in a team setting.
Also Read: MongoDB Real World Use Cases: Key Features & Practical Applications
Example: "Technical Skills: UiPath, Automation Anywhere, Python, SQL, REST APIs
Soft Skills: Communication, Problem-solving, Team Collaboration"
Including a well-rounded skillset will highlight your technical proficiency while also showing you are adaptable in team settings.
5. Certifications: Relevant RPA and IT-Related Certifications
Certifications are an essential part of your RPA developer resume as they validate your expertise and commitment to professional development. Highlight certifications in RPA tools like UiPath, Automation Anywhere, or Blue Prism, as well as any related IT certifications.
Certifications show employers that you have specialized knowledge and are serious about staying current with industry standards and emerging technologies.
6. Additional Sections: Achievements, Hobbies, or Portfolio Links (if Applicable)
While not mandatory, additional sections can enrich your RPA developer resume and provide a more holistic view of you as a professional. This can include:
Example: "Portfolio: [GitHub link]
Awarded 'Best Automation Solution' for leading a project that improved workflow efficiency by 35%."
These additional sections can help provide more depth and showcase your commitment to continuous learning and professional development.
By incorporating these sections, you will create a well-rounded RPA developer resume that highlights your skills, experience, and qualifications.
Now that your content is structured, let’s make sure your resume gets noticed with smart formatting techniques.
Use clear formatting for readability and impact. Organized resumes help recruiters quickly find key qualifications.
Consistent and professional formatting reflects your attention to detail and helps hiring managers quickly find the information they need.
Here are the best practices to follow when formatting your RPA developer resume.
1. Use Professional Fonts and Consistent Formatting
The fonts you choose for your RPA developer resume should be easy to read and professional. Avoid using too many font styles or sizes, as this can create a cluttered look. Stick to one or two fonts at most, and use bold or italics sparingly for emphasis.
Ensure that headings, subheadings, and body text are consistent throughout the resume. This helps in creating a clean, professional look that is easy for recruiters to navigate.
This formatting consistency ensures a professional and polished appearance.
2. Maintain Concise and Clear Bullet Points
Bullet points help break down information and make your resume easy to scan. Instead of lengthy paragraphs, use short, impactful bullet points to highlight your achievements, skills, and experience. Each bullet should begin with an action verb and focus on measurable results.
Make sure each bullet point is concise and relevant to the position you're applying for. Focus on accomplishments and skills that align with the job requirements.
This approach keeps your resume streamlined and ensures key information is easy to find.
3. Stick to One or Two Pages for Length
The length of your RPA developer resume is important. Aim to keep it to one or two pages—this is the ideal length for most hiring managers. Too much information can overwhelm recruiters, while too little may not provide enough context for your experience.
For a more senior role, ensure that the content remains relevant, highlighting your most impactful accomplishments. Avoid including outdated skills or irrelevant roles to keep the resume concise.
This format ensures your resume fits within the expected length while providing enough detail to make a strong case for your candidacy.
4. Save the Resume in PDF Format to Preserve Structure
Once your RPA developer resume is complete, save it as a PDF file. This ensures that the formatting remains intact, regardless of the device or software the recruiter uses to open it. Unlike Word documents, PDFs prevent accidental formatting shifts that can make your resume look unprofessional.
Additionally, many Applicant Tracking Systems (ATS) can read PDFs (with a few exceptions), but be sure to avoid overly complex formatting like images or graphics, which may not be properly parsed.
5. Use Adequate White Space and Section Breaks
Adequate white space between sections, headings, and text blocks is crucial for readability. Overcrowded resumes are difficult to read, and hiring managers may overlook key information. Keep the margins at around 1 inch and use spacing between sections to ensure your resume is easy to navigate.
This layout helps maintain a clean and organized look, making it easier for hiring managers to scan the resume.
6. Tailor the Resume for Each Job Application
Tailor your resume to match each job's requirements. Look closely at the job description and ensure that your skills, experience, and projects reflect the key qualifications the employer is seeking.
Customizing your resume for each position increases your chances of being shortlisted, as it directly aligns your experience with the employer's needs.
By following these best practices, you can create a well-organized RPA developer resume that stands out to recruiters. A resume with consistent formatting, concise bullet points, and relevant, tailored information is key to capturing attention and advancing your career.
Also Read: 40+ RPA Interview Questions Every Developer Should Know in 2025
Now, let's take a look at real-world examples with five RPA developer resume samples to give you practical insights into formatting and presentation.
This section provides you with RPA developer resume samples that demonstrate how to structure your resume effectively. These examples will guide you in presenting your experience, skills, and achievements in a clear, compelling manner.
Each resume sample covers essential sections, including professional summaries, work experience, skills, education, and certifications. Customize these samples to showcase your unique strengths in RPA development.
1. Entry-Level RPA Developer Resume Sample
For those starting their career in RPA development, this resume focuses on education, relevant coursework, and any hands-on projects or internships. It highlights your potential and transferable skills.
|
Also Read: RPA Developer Salary in India: For Freshers & Experienced [2025]
This resume focuses on foundational skills and education while highlighting relevant internships to provide proof of your RPA-related experience.
2. Mid-Level RPA Developer Resume Sample
For candidates with a few years of experience, this sample showcases your hands-on achievements and the impact you've made in previous roles. Focus on quantifiable results and advanced RPA tools.
|
This resume focuses on demonstrating experience and impact, highlighting leadership roles and measurable outcomes from RPA projects.
3. Senior RPA Developer Resume Sample
For senior-level developers, the focus shifts to leadership, strategic contributions, and managing large-scale projects. This sample highlights significant achievements and the ability to drive organizational change.
|
This resume showcases leadership skills, high-level project management, and measurable results, positioning you as an expert in the field.
4. Transitioning from IT to RPA Developer Resume Sample
For professionals transitioning from IT to RPA development, the focus is on emphasizing transferable IT skills, technical expertise, and RPA-related certifications or training.
|
Also Read: RPA Developer: Skills, Career, and How to Become One
This resume bridges IT experience with RPA skills, demonstrating how your previous expertise can be applied to automation roles.
5. Freelance or Contract RPA Developer Resume Sample
For freelancers or contractors, the resume should emphasize flexibility, a diverse portfolio of projects, and the ability to deliver results independently.
|
This resume highlights freelance flexibility while showcasing key projects and client outcomes, demonstrating your capability as an independent RPA developer.
Please Note: These resume samples serve as a general reference and may not reflect precise formatting, word count, or industry-specific executive track requirements. They should be customized to align with the specific role, sector, and professional level.
A strong foundation in RPA development is key to increasing your chances of getting hired. upGrad offers specialized programs that provide the practical skills needed for a standout RPA developer resume.
Succeeding as an RPA developer requires both technical expertise and the ability to apply that knowledge to real-world automation projects. Many professionals struggle to bridge the gap between theory and practice in RPA.
upGrad's specialized RPA development programs are designed to fill this gap, offering structured learning, hands-on projects, and expert mentorship. These courses will help you develop the required skills to create a standout RPA developer resume.
Here are some top courses (including free ones) to kickstart your RPA career:
Contact upGrad’s counselors or visit your nearest career center for personalized guidance. With the right resources, you’ll be equipped to tackle challenges in RPA development and craft an impressive resume that highlights your skills!
Expand your expertise with the best resources available. Browse the programs below to find your ideal fit in Best Machine Learning and AI Courses Online.
Discover in-demand Machine Learning skills to expand your expertise. Explore the programs below to find the perfect fit for your goals.
Discover popular AI and ML blogs and free courses to deepen your expertise. Explore the programs below to find your perfect fit.
Get Free Consultation
By submitting, I accept the T&C and
Privacy Policy
Top Resources